OK, made some progress yesterday.So, I'm going in tomorrow to do the paperwork and get an updated appraisal on the 2022 Volkswagen Tiguan SE R-Line. They appraised it for $32k in November.
I'll owe roughly $17k after my original 2021 Gladiator trade.
I did some homework this weekend:
Original VW Dealer: $29k
CarMax: $35k
AutoBuy (dealt with before): came in @ $33k, showed them the CarMax offer, said 'OK' $35.2k
WePayMoreAuto (the sign spinners when you pull out of CarMax): $35.5k
I'm figuring I'll owe roughly $1200 tax on 17k, but if I can get them to match the CarMax offer, I'm good to go!!!
